應(yīng)用程序的構(gòu)建過程如下:

1. 首先,將Java源代碼編譯成字節(jié)碼文件(.class文件)。

2. 接下來,使用Dx工具將Java字節(jié)碼轉(zhuǎn)換為DEX字節(jié)碼。DEX字節(jié)碼是一種針對(duì)Android設(shè)備優(yōu)化的字節(jié)碼格式,它可以更好地管理內(nèi)存和資源。

3. 然后,將DEX字節(jié)碼與資源文件一起打包成APK文件。APK文件的基本目錄結(jié)構(gòu)包括META-INF目錄、lib目錄、res目錄、assets目錄和AndroidManifest.xml文件。

4. 最如何將數(shù)據(jù)庫打包到apk中發(fā)布后,將APK文件進(jìn)行數(shù)字簽名以確保安全性。數(shù)字簽名是APK文件的一種安全機(jī)制,用于驗(yàn)證APK的來源和完整性。

總結(jié)起來,生成APK文件的過程包括代碼編譯、DEX轉(zhuǎn)換、資源打包和數(shù)字簽名等步驟。通過這些步驟,你可以將Android應(yīng)用程序打包成APK文件,方便在Android設(shè)備上安裝和運(yùn)行。這為開發(fā)者提供了一種將代碼部署到用戶設(shè)備的簡(jiǎn)單而有效的方式。

未經(jīng)允許不得轉(zhuǎn)載:亦門 » android生成apk名怎么做?

相關(guān)推薦